KPIT Technologies Ltd’s stock price declined sharply to a fresh 52-week low of Rs.543.4 on 18 September 2026, marking a significant milestone in its ongoing downward trajectory. The stock underperformed its sector and broader market indices, reflecting a series of financial and market challenges that have weighed on investor sentiment over the past year.
KPIT Technologies Ltd Falls to 52-Week Low of Rs 543.4 as Sell-Off Deepens

Price Action and Market Context

For the fifth consecutive session, KPIT Technologies Ltd closed lower, underperforming its sector by 1.13% and touching an intraday low of Rs 543.4, a level not seen in the past 52 weeks. This contrasts sharply with the broader market, where the Sensex opened higher at 74,575.24 and is trading just 4.01% above its own 52-week low. The technical picture for KPIT Technologies Ltd remains bearish, with the stock trading below all major moving averages — 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day. Weekly MACD shows mild bullishness, but monthly indicators such as Bollinger Bands and KST lean bearish, reinforcing the downward momentum. The daily moving averages confirm a sustained negative trend, suggesting that the stock is yet to find a technical floor.

Financial Performance and Profitability Concerns

The recent quarterly results have added to the pressure on KPIT Technologies Ltd. Net sales declined by 2.1% in the June 2026 quarter, marking the second consecutive quarter of negative results. Profit after tax (PAT) over the latest six months fell by 32.74% to Rs 280.23 crores, while interest expenses surged by 82.39% to Rs 68.34 crores over nine months. Despite these setbacks, the company maintains a net-debt-free status, which is a positive from a balance sheet perspective. However, the growing interest expense suggests increased borrowing or higher cost of funds, which could weigh on future profitability if not addressed.

Valuation and Shareholder Sentiment

Valuation metrics for KPIT Technologies Ltd present a mixed picture. The stock trades at a price-to-book value of 4.3, which is attractive relative to its peers’ historical averages, especially considering its return on equity (ROE) of 19.2%. This suggests that the market may be pricing in risks beyond just valuation multiples. The company’s long-term fundamentals remain robust, with an average ROE of 23.96% and annual net sales growth of 25.58%, alongside operating profit growth of 34.13%. Yet, the recent 22.4% decline in profits over the past year contrasts sharply with these strengths, reflecting near-term headwinds. Adding to the cautious sentiment, promoters have reduced their stake by 0.82% in the previous quarter, now holding 38.6%. This reduction may be interpreted as a signal of diminished confidence in the company’s immediate prospects, which could influence market perception and liquidity.

Long-Term Performance and Sector Comparison

Over the last three years, KPIT Technologies Ltd has underperformed the BSE500 index, reflecting persistent challenges in maintaining investor confidence. The stock’s 58.22% decline over the past year far exceeds the Sensex’s 10.20% fall, underscoring the company-specific pressures it faces within the Computers - Software & Consulting sector. This underperformance is compounded by the fact that the Sensex itself is trading below its 50-day moving average, indicating broader market caution, though mega-cap stocks are currently leading gains.

Technical Indicators and Market Sentiment

Technical signals for KPIT Technologies Ltd are predominantly bearish on the daily and monthly timeframes. While weekly MACD and RSI show mild bullish tendencies, monthly Bollinger Bands and KST indicators remain bearish. The stock’s position below all major moving averages reinforces the prevailing downtrend.
